Another dumb question
Need to check the ignition timing (1984 B21A with PAS).
I can't for the life of me see a timing mark on the edge of the crank pulley (either the double pulley for the alternator or the single PAS pulley). Am I just being thick? Is there really a timing mark on the pulley? If so, how is it marked? Getting annoyed with such a simple thing now!!!!!!! |
